Mirror reflection — subject and reflection must agree

What this stresses: Geometric self-consistency. A reflection doubles every error: the model has to keep two views of one face in agreement for the whole clip.
960×544 · 124f (5.17 s) · 24 fps · seed 424242 · identical prompt in every cell. Same seed does not mean same take — steps, sampler and LoRA all change the trajectory, so judge character rather than shot-for-shot identity.

baseline · 20 steps + Spectrum
No LoRA, plus SpectrumApplyMiniMaxH3 (v0.1.9 defaults: degree 1, warmup 1, one-point bootstrap) skipping DiT evaluations.
108s · floor -30.4 · med -26.9 · peak -0.9 dB · jitter 111.5 · detail 0.034
ema-ckpt500 · 8 steps + Spectrum
Turbo LoRA and Spectrum stacked. Only possible since Spectrum v0.1.9 — the old warmup_steps=5 default left no forecastable window at 8 steps.
61s · floor -33.0 · med -27.0 · peak 1.3 dB · jitter 111.2 · detail 0.032
ema-ckpt500 · 8 steps + SageAttention
Turbo LoRA with SageAttention 2.2.0 (KJNodes patch, backend auto). Unlike Spectrum, Sage preserves the take — 0.955 frame correlation against plain emck8.

v4-step600 EMA · 8 steps
larryvrh's new v4 training recipe (step 600, EMA) — a different training line, not a further ckpt of the 500/850 series. Single-variable swap against emck8, the round-4 winner: same steps, sampler, scheduler, shift and strength.
78s · floor -31.3 · med -26.4 · peak 2.4 dB · jitter 156.9 · detail 0.084
v4-step600 non-EMA · 8 steps
The same v4 checkpoint without EMA averaging. Re-runs the EMA axis on the new recipe — on the v1 line the gap was 6.3 dB of noise floor (emck8 −5.6 vs ck8 +0.7).
77s · floor -38.4 · med -32.2 · peak 2.3 dB · jitter 168.5 · detail 0.085
v4-step600 EMA · 8 steps · euler + beta
drbaph's recommended config for the pruned conversion we load: 8 steps, euler, beta scheduler. Varies sampler *and* scheduler against the rest of the grid, so it is only readable against v4e8, not against the res_multistep columns.
77s · floor -33.3 · med -27.8 · peak 2.3 dB · jitter 165.3 · detail 0.047
v4-step600 EMA · 4 steps
Probes the one regression larryvrh documents for v4: motion smear / trailing ghosting at 4 steps under fast motion, which 6–8 steps is said to remove. rapid-cuts, hands-dexterity and polyphony-foreground are where it should show.
45s · floor -33.7 · med -21.2 · peak 2.1 dB · jitter 260.1 · detail 0.170
v4-step600 EMA · 8 steps + SageAttention
Re-bases the production accelerator onto v4. emck8-sage (45 s, 3.66×, 0.955 correlation) is the current production config; if v4e8 dethrones emck8 this is what replaces it. Sage is an attention-backend swap and so should be weight-independent — this checks that.
50s · floor -33.1 · med -27.2 · peak 1.6 dB · jitter 167.1 · detail 0.082
ema-ckpt500 · 8 steps · euler + beta
Control for v4e8-eb, which varies LoRA, sampler and scheduler at once. Putting drbaph's euler+beta on the weights we already have 10 scenes of isolates the sampler/scheduler axis, so an eb win can be attributed to the config rather than to v4.
